Skip to main content
ZS

Zoë Smith

Editor-in-Chief and Founder, Ghouls Magazine

Ghouls Magazine

z***@business.itn.co.uk Upgrade
No phone on file
London, United Kingdom

About

Queen of extreme horror 🖤 Ex-Founder & EIC @ghoulsmagazine | Words: Second Sight, 88 Films, Unearthe...

Upgrade to read full bio

Recent Article

Electric lorries are on the move — but can infrastructure keep up? - ITN Business

Upgrade for article links
336 total articles published · Chief